Runoff under low pressure center Pivot systems

Reduced low pressure center Pivot irrigation systems can use one-third less energy than their high-pressure counterparts. But they also may increase irrigation water runoff and soil erosion unless properly sited and managed, according to a four-year study by the University of Nebraska. Pivot sprinklers

Upgrading Pivot sprinklers is a prime way to boost efficiency. Sprinkler technology has evolved significantly over the last few decades, so if older model sprinklers are being used, efficiency might be increased by updating the package.
